Kelly Ripa wants to be on her kids’ schedule

Tags: News, Quotes

Kellyripa_3A few years ago actress and co-host Kelly Ripa, 37, had a lot on her plate to juggle.  Not only did she have her talk show responsibilities with Live with Regis and Kelly alongside Regis Philbin, she also played Faith Fairfield in the sitcom Hope and Faith, and was a mother to three young kids with her husband, Mark Consuelos, 37.  Now, with her sitcom having wrapped in 2006, Kelly is enjoying the advantages of her hosting schedule — which she tapes in the morning — and dedicating more of her time to her kids Michael Joseph, who will be 11 on June 2, Lola Grace, who will be 7 on June 16, and Joaquin Antonio, 5.

My job is not very time consuming — at all.  I really am scheduled to pick up the kids from school every day.  It used to be very difficult because I had the sitcom and the talk show.  It required a lot of patience from my children; it required them to come to me a lot.  I like it much better now because I don’t think my kids should be on my schedule.  I feel like I should be more on their schedule.
